Воскресенье, 24 Ноября 2024, 17:32

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Результаты поиска
SaladinДата: Суббота, 02 Июня 2012, 23:30 | Сообщение # 741 | Тема: Вопрос насчет обнаружения.
заслуженный участник
Сейчас нет на сайте
Не пудри людям мозги с треугольниками. Обьясни как это будет выглядеть в игре и зачем это нужно.

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 19:51 | Сообщение # 742 | Тема: Ничего не происходит при нажатии
заслуженный участник
Сейчас нет на сайте
Quote (realyhead)
что делать?

Написать чуть больше.
Код, исходник, хоть что нибудь, с чем можно работать.


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 19:47 | Сообщение # 743 | Тема: Помогите сделать, чтобы вокруг фонарика было темно
заслуженный участник
Сейчас нет на сайте
Ты видел сколько обьектов одновременно находится в пределах вида? smile
700 обьектов любую игру положат на лопатки, без всякого освещения. Это раз.
Тест показал минимально 30 фпс на интегрированной видеокарточке S3G. Это два.
Кроме того освещение стилизовано под террарию, умник. Это три.

НА сурфейсах будет работать нормально не у всех. То, что в твои игры играет 10 человек, из которых у одного не работает сурф не значит, что он не работает у одного единственного человека в стране. Лично я на имеющихся в моем распоряжении восьми компьютерах (почти на всех видеокарты последнего поколения) на трех имею проблемы с отрисовкой. Если тебе плевать как выглядят твои игры - дело твое, но не вводи людей в заблуждение. Сурфейсы не работают нормально.

Это к стати не с твоим дублем я спорил в прошлый раз? Не у тебя случайно максимум в 4 фпс получился на динамическом освещении "как в террарии"? biggrin

Добавлено (02.06.2012, 19:47)
---------------------------------------------
К стати как вариант можно использовать вместо мерзкого сурфейса спрайт с прозрачностью в нужном месте. Ресурсов съест столько же, сколько сурфейс, а лагать не будет ни у кого.


Анбаннэд. Хэлоу эгин =)

Сообщение отредактировал Saladin - Суббота, 02 Июня 2012, 20:07
SaladinДата: Суббота, 02 Июня 2012, 17:32 | Сообщение # 744 | Тема: Помогите сделать, чтобы вокруг фонарика было темно
заслуженный участник
Сейчас нет на сайте
Я бы не стал использовать сурфейсы. Поддерживает его видеокарта их или нет, но у остальных это будет рулетка. Вполне адекватное освещение можно сделать на дата структуре типа ds_grid. Очень удобно, смотрится красиво и работает достаточно быстро. Правда ума нужно приложить чуть больше чем с сурфами.

Добавлено (02.06.2012, 17:32)
---------------------------------------------
Вот пример.
Я его делал для специально для спора с одним недалеким человечком, который все мямлил про медленную работу такого освещения. Мне нужен был рабочий пример а не мануал, так что код не комментирован и понимать его будет сложновато, но если решишь разобраться то пример будет тебе полезен. Дерзай smile


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 14:38 | Сообщение # 745 | Тема: Функция
заслуженный участник
Сейчас нет на сайте
Аргументы это обычные переменные, поэтому сказать им что-то можно только в двух узких случаях. Если переменная должна быть числом используется проверка is_real(x), если строка - is_string(x). Так как айди обьекта это его порядковый номер (число соответственно), то программа не сможет его отличить от координат (тоже число). В комментариях к функции просто на заметку напиши что ест каждый аргумент smile

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 10:48 | Сообщение # 746 | Тема: Minestory: Путники Края
заслуженный участник
Сейчас нет на сайте
Quote (Atantius_DS)
В каком месте я спрашивал разрешение

Тут -->
Code
Стоит мне реализовывать идею?


А после этой строчки даже без чтения первого поста моя уверенность стала абсолютной:
Quote (Atantius_DS)
рпг на тему minecraft

Ох этот гребаный стыд...


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 10:00 | Сообщение # 747 | Тема: Minestory: Путники Края
заслуженный участник
Сейчас нет на сайте
Я даже читать не стал, сразу проголосовал за бред. Почему? Вменяемый человек не спрашивает разрешения на воплощение идеи. Ну а уж варианты ответов так и вовсе намекают на единственное возможное решение.

Там хоть интересно? smile


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 02:03 | Сообщение # 748 | Тема: Концепт-арт
заслуженный участник
Сейчас нет на сайте
Это и есть тайлсет. А раскладка специально для того чтобы можно было оценить общую картину smile

Анбаннэд. Хэлоу эгин =)
SaladinДата: Суббота, 02 Июня 2012, 01:57 | Сообщение # 749 | Тема: Концепт-арт
заслуженный участник
Сейчас нет на сайте
Не вытерпел! smile
Не решался выкладывать, но шило в заднице не дает покоя. Мне нравится, значит должно понравиться и другим. В общем вооот:


Анбаннэд. Хэлоу эгин =)
SaladinДата: Пятница, 01 Июня 2012, 14:38 | Сообщение # 750 | Тема: Falcoware - Заработай на своих играх!
заслуженный участник
Сейчас нет на сайте
Quote (Drish)
один начальник останется)

Если себя не уволит, как остальных дОрмоедов smile


Анбаннэд. Хэлоу эгин =)
SaladinДата: Четверг, 31 Мая 2012, 14:45 | Сообщение # 751 | Тема: Life killer
заслуженный участник
Сейчас нет на сайте
Quote (Transced)
ну это стиль графики

Отсутствие стиля стилем может считаться только формально. Так как кроме скриншотов оценить нечего, то мой вердикт - УУУУУУУУУУГ. Очень.


Анбаннэд. Хэлоу эгин =)
SaladinДата: Среда, 30 Мая 2012, 15:33 | Сообщение # 752 | Тема: Проблема низкой скорости обработки события Step
заслуженный участник
Сейчас нет на сайте
Quote (GameMix)
тут дело в самом Game Maker'е.

А чаще дело в кривіх руках. Но не суть.
Шаг, это такая специфическая вещь...
Во-первых, стоит увеличить скорость комнаты. Больше шагов - выше скорость.
Во-вторых, если увеличение скорости комнаты не очень помогло, стоит пересмотреть свою политику к циклическим событиям аки степ и драв, ну еще колижен и нажатие клавиш в некоторой степени. Код, который не нужно выполнять каждый шаг, не стоит пихать ни в степ ни в драв, это доводит и без того агонизирующий гм до состояния эпилепсии. Исключительно вредным в данном случае является загрузка, создание, копирование игровых ресурсов.

Есть конечно специфические случаи, где танцы с бубном, оптимизация, молитвы и проклятия не дадут ничего. Это уже специфика движка. Но в большинстве случаев все таки можно обойтись стандартными медикаментозными средствами.


Анбаннэд. Хэлоу эгин =)
SaladinДата: Среда, 30 Мая 2012, 14:21 | Сообщение # 753 | Тема: spr_+argument0 = spr_mp446
заслуженный участник
Сейчас нет на сайте
Тогда поставим вопрос ребром.
Какое отношение имеет ЭТО:
Quote (миха)
weapon[i]=spr_+argument0
wdr[i]=spr_hero_+argument0

к вот ЭТОМУ:
Quote (миха)
for (i=0 ; i>5 ; i+=1) {
{if weapon[i] =-1
{weapon[i]=spr_mp446
wdr[i]=spr_hero_mp446
sound_play(s_pickup_weapon)
}
}
}

?


Анбаннэд. Хэлоу эгин =)
SaladinДата: Среда, 30 Мая 2012, 12:05 | Сообщение # 754 | Тема: spr_+argument0 = spr_mp446
заслуженный участник
Сейчас нет на сайте
Ну спрайт героя думаю анимирован, а спрайт самого оружия? Что там анимировать? Передергивание затвора? smile
Автоматизировать простейшую операцию скриптом, когда ее можно так же легко запихать в свич/кейс, выглядит мягко говоря странно. Вот если бы таких "пушек" было полсотни, это да, хотя все равно вручную придется индексы каждой писать. Не понимаю...


Анбаннэд. Хэлоу эгин =)
SaladinДата: Среда, 30 Мая 2012, 11:48 | Сообщение # 755 | Тема: Концепт-арт
заслуженный участник
Сейчас нет на сайте
В какой то мере симпатично, но эти угловатые края и неоправданные блики на них портят абсолютно все.

Анбаннэд. Хэлоу эгин =)
SaladinДата: Среда, 30 Мая 2012, 11:35 | Сообщение # 756 | Тема: spr_+argument0 = spr_mp446
заслуженный участник
Сейчас нет на сайте
У тебя всего пять ячеек массива. "Суффикс" или что оно там такое содержит помимо цифр еще и буквы, что делает практически невозможным перебор с помощью цикла. Какой смысл в этих извращенных манипуляциях? Не проще ли использовать строго нумерованный имаж_индекс и всего один спрайт? Зачем специально усложнять себе жизнь?

Анбаннэд. Хэлоу эгин =)
SaladinДата: Вторник, 29 Мая 2012, 21:51 | Сообщение # 757 | Тема: Рабочее название "Сим-сим-сити"
заслуженный участник
Сейчас нет на сайте
Я тут ни при чем, просто вы апаете мертвую тему, и хороните активные и весьма интересные. Вам оно из принципа надо?

Анбаннэд. Хэлоу эгин =)
SaladinДата: Вторник, 29 Мая 2012, 19:44 | Сообщение # 758 | Тема: Рабочее название "Сим-сим-сити"
заслуженный участник
Сейчас нет на сайте
Урезоньте свой оффтоп. Хочется поговорить - идите во флейм. Не сорите где не просят.

Анбаннэд. Хэлоу эгин =)
SaladinДата: Вторник, 29 Мая 2012, 13:34 | Сообщение # 759 | Тема: Помощь в интерфейсе
заслуженный участник
Сейчас нет на сайте
Quote (MadMax)
с ini файлами не получится, продумал логику и понял, что все это муторно. нужно записывать id квеста в отдельный фаил построчно, потом в журнале парсить весь фаил, все id сверять с id файла с названиями и описаниями квестов. + награды еще же

Айди квеста построчно? Прямо все 30 сантиметров? smile
Парсить файл? Весь? Награды? Описания?

Ты хотя бы коротко справку по ини читал? То есть не так... Ты понял то, что прочитал?


Анбаннэд. Хэлоу эгин =)
SaladinДата: Понедельник, 28 Мая 2012, 17:14 | Сообщение # 760 | Тема: проблема с фонами
заслуженный участник
Сейчас нет на сайте
Даже не из-за обращения (оно происходит каждый шаг), а из-за того, что в память постоянно подгружается новый бекграунд и не выгружается старый. Затраты памяти на это, постоянно растущее множество, выливаются в тормоза, вплоть до полного зависания.
К стати для экономии памяти ресурсы нужно не только вовремя загружать, но и вовремя выгружать. Иначе смысл просто теряется.


Анбаннэд. Хэлоу эгин =)

Сообщение отредактировал Saladin - Понедельник, 28 Мая 2012, 17:15
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г